Doctor of Philosophy (Ph.D.) Biotechnology

Ph.D. in Biotechnology is the programme that offers the highest level of training in critical areas of scientific research. Ph.D. in Biotechnology is designed to train scientists in using management principles, understanding management issues for research enterprises and technology ventures, and integrating specialist training in biotechnology and research.
Ph.D. in Biotechnology incorporates varied topics like Biochemistry, Virology, Chemistry, Microbiology, Genetics, Immunology, and Engineering. It also possesses tight connections and associations with numerous other subjects like Cropping system and Crop Management, Agriculture and Animal Husbandry, Health and Medicine, Ecology, utilizes living things, particularly cells and bacteria, in industrial procedures. With the need for biotechnologists, development prospects in this domain are rising. After Ph.D. in Biotechnology, one can attain any objective in the field of research and corporate. The research opportunities in the Biotechnology sector are enormous. It incorporates the most elevated form of investigation in the domain of cancer, immunology, food science, stem-cell research, forensics, pharmacology, environmental science, genetic research, bioinformatics, and various other biochemical and biological processes.

Program Educational Objectives (PEO's)
PEO-1 | The programme aims to enlighten an interdisciplinary group of researchers with backgrounds in biophysics, biochemistry, biology, and chemistry in the applied biological and chemical sciences of biotechnology for employment in academia, administration, and industry |
PEO-2 | To enable students from numerous disciplines to experience research in intimate connection to biomedical engineering students while working in the field of biotechnology |
PEO-3 | To prepare students for careers of constructive service to society in academia, government, industry, and health-related fields |
PEO-4 | To engage determined students in locations not encountered in their prior academic lives and to get them to a fundamental knowledge that will permit them to perform translational research, from conceptual design through in vivo testing with an eye towards clinical implementation |
PEO-5 | To provide interdisciplinary analysis and academic possibilities to solve problems that will enhance the quality of life for those sorrowing from health-related diseases and disorders |
